On September 18, 2025, Longevity Xplorer (LongX) will be hosting the first-ever “Youth in Longevity Biotech Showcase”, a virtual event featuring lightning talks from young professionals in longevity fellowships around the world. The event will cover fellow contributions and highlight the importance in supporting the next generation of leaders in aging biology. LongX welcomes the entire longevity community to attend.

A range of prestigious aging and longevity-focused fellowships will be represented. This includes but is not limited to:

LongX – Xplore Program

A remote fellowship designed to help early career professionals apply themselves in the longevity biotech sector through courses, mentorship, and industry placements.

Lifespan Research Institute – Summer Scholars & Post-Baccalaurate Fellowship

A program for undergraduate students and recent graduates to conduct biomedical research on age-related diseases under the guidance of a scientific mentor, with an emphasis on developing both laboratory and communication skills.

Buck Postbaccalaureate Research Program

A 1-2 year program for recent college graduates to gain intensive research experience in aging and age-related diseases at the Buck Institute before pursuing an advanced degree or a career in the biotech industry.

TIME Initiative

An aging biology fellowship that serves as a talent accelerator, supporting ambitious future leaders with knowledge, community, mentorship, and project support.

This event serves to:

  • Promote cross-pollination between aging biology-focused fellowships
  • Improve transparency in program developments and outcomes
  • Increase support for aging biology training programs
  • Foster a networking space for those interested in talent and education in longevity

About LongX

LongX was launched in 2023 as a platform for youth interested in longevity. We prioritize fostering innovation and interdisciplinary collaboration, aiming for both short-term impact and long-term progress. We encourage exploration beyond traditional roles and aim to equip future experts with the skills to drive progress.
